画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
MSP430F4784IPZ

MSP430F4784IPZ

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, Internet of Things (IoT) devices, and other applications requiring low power consumption and high performance.
  • Characteristics:
    • Low power consumption
    • High performance
    • Integrated peripherals
    • Flexible clocking options
  • Package: Plastic Quad Flat Package (PQFP)
  • Essence: The MSP430F4784IPZ is a microcontroller designed for low-power applications that require high performance and integrated peripherals.
  • Packaging/Quantity: Available in tape and reel packaging with a quantity of 250 units per reel.

Specifications

  • Core: 16-bit RISC CPU
  • Clock Speed: Up to 25 MHz
  • Flash Memory: 128 KB
  • RAM: 10 KB
  • Operating Voltage Range: 1.8V to 3.6V
  • Digital I/O Pins: 87
  • Analog Inputs: 12
  • Communication Interfaces: UART, SPI, I2C
  • Timers: 5x 16-bit timers
  • ADC: 12-bit SAR ADC with 16 channels
  • DMA: 2x DMA controllers
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The MSP430F4784IPZ has a total of 100 pins. Here is a brief overview of the pin configuration:

  • Port 1: P1.0 to P1.7
  • Port 2: P2.0 to P2.7
  • Port 3: P3.0 to P3.7
  • Port 4: P4.0 to P4.7
  • Port 5: P5.0 to P5.7
  • Port 6: P6.0 to P6.7
  • Port 7: P7.0 to P7.7
  • Port 8: P8.0 to P8.7
  • Port 9: P9.0 to P9.7
  • Port 10: P10.0 to P10.7

For a detailed pin configuration diagram, please refer to the official datasheet.

Functional Features

  • Low power consumption modes for energy-efficient operation.
  • Integrated peripherals such as UART, SPI, I2C, and ADC for easy interfacing with external devices.
  • Flexible clocking options to optimize performance and power consumption.
  • Multiple timers for precise timing control.
  • DMA controllers for efficient data transfer between memory and peripherals.

Advantages and Disadvantages

Advantages: - Low power consumption enables longer battery life in portable applications. - High-performance CPU allows for faster execution of tasks. - Integrated peripherals simplify system design and reduce external component count. - Flexible clocking options provide versatility in different application scenarios.

Disadvantages: - Limited flash memory and RAM compared to some other microcontrollers in the same category. - Higher cost compared to entry-level microcontrollers with similar features.

Working Principles

The MSP430F4784IPZ operates based on the von Neumann architecture. It executes instructions fetched from its internal flash memory using a 16-bit RISC CPU core. The microcontroller can operate at various clock speeds and offers low-power modes to conserve energy when idle or performing less demanding tasks. Integrated peripherals allow for seamless communication with external devices, while timers and DMA controllers enhance overall system performance.

Detailed Application Field Plans

The MSP430F4784IPZ is suitable for a wide range of applications, including but not limited to:

  1. Internet of Things (IoT) devices: The low power consumption and integrated peripherals make it ideal for IoT applications that require long battery life and connectivity.
  2. Home automation systems: The microcontroller can control various home automation functions such as lighting, temperature, and security systems.
  3. Industrial automation: It can be used in industrial control systems for monitoring and controlling processes.
  4. Medical devices: The low power consumption and high performance make it suitable for portable medical devices such as glucose meters and blood pressure monitors.

Detailed and Complete Alternative Models

  1. MSP430F4783IPZ: Similar to the MSP430F4784IPZ but with reduced flash memory (64 KB) and RAM (8 KB).
  2. MSP430F4782IPZ: Similar to the MSP430F4784IPZ but with reduced flash memory (32 KB) and RAM (4 KB).
  3. MSP430F4781IPZ: Similar to the MSP430F4784IPZ but with reduced flash memory (16 KB) and RAM (2 KB).

These alternative models offer different memory configurations to cater to varying application requirements while maintaining similar features and functionality.

Word count: 560 words

技術ソリューションにおける MSP430F4784IPZ の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of MSP430F4784IPZ in technical solutions:

  1. Q: What is MSP430F4784IPZ? A: MSP430F4784IPZ is a microcontroller from Texas Instruments' MSP430 family, designed for embedded applications.

  2. Q: What are the key features of MSP430F4784IPZ? A: Some key features include a 16-bit RISC architecture, low power consumption, integrated peripherals, and a wide operating voltage range.

  3. Q: What are some typical applications of MSP430F4784IPZ? A: MSP430F4784IPZ is commonly used in applications such as industrial control systems, smart meters, medical devices, and consumer electronics.

  4. Q: How does MSP430F4784IPZ achieve low power consumption? A: The microcontroller incorporates various power-saving modes, such as standby mode, sleep mode, and real-time clock module, which help reduce power consumption.

  5. Q: Can I interface MSP430F4784IPZ with other devices or sensors? A: Yes, MSP430F4784IPZ has multiple built-in peripherals like UART, SPI, I2C, ADC, and GPIOs, allowing easy interfacing with external devices and sensors.

  6. Q: What programming language can be used with MSP430F4784IPZ? A: MSP430F4784IPZ can be programmed using C/C++ or assembly language. Texas Instruments provides an IDE called Code Composer Studio for development.

  7. Q: Is MSP430F4784IPZ suitable for battery-powered applications? A: Yes, MSP430F4784IPZ is known for its low power consumption, making it ideal for battery-powered applications where power efficiency is crucial.

  8. Q: Can MSP430F4784IPZ communicate with other microcontrollers or devices? A: Yes, MSP430F4784IPZ supports various communication protocols like SPI, I2C, and UART, enabling seamless communication with other microcontrollers or devices.

  9. Q: What is the maximum clock frequency of MSP430F4784IPZ? A: The maximum clock frequency of MSP430F4784IPZ is 25 MHz, allowing for fast execution of instructions and efficient processing.

  10. Q: Are there any development boards available for MSP430F4784IPZ? A: Yes, Texas Instruments offers development boards like MSP-EXP430F4784 LaunchPad, which provide a convenient platform for prototyping and testing with MSP430F4784IPZ.

Please note that these questions and answers are general in nature and may vary depending on specific requirements and use cases.